WebOne SCQF credit point represents a notional 10 hours of learning. So, for example, if you achieve a Higher course (SCQF level 6) with 24 SCQF credits, you will have done about 240 hours of learning. Why is SCQF information shown on the certificate? WebNotional Learning Time. The number of hours, which it is expected a learner (at a particular level) will spend, on average, to achieve. the specified learning outcomes at that level. It includes all learning relevant to achievement of the learning. outcomes e.g. directed study, essential practical work, project work, private study and assessment.

WebNotional hours. Credits are a measure of the notional hours or learning time that it would take the average student to meet the prescribed outcomes. The South African Qualifications Authority (SAQA) uses a credit system based on the idea that one credit equals ten notional (assumed) hours of learning. 8 credits would thus equal 80 hours, etcetera.
